Inground Sprinkler Repair in Ventura County, CA
Inground sprinkler repair services focus on restoring the functionality of underground irrigation systems that are essential for maintaining healthy lawns and landscaped areas. These projects typically involve fixing broken or leaking pipes, replacing damaged sprinkler heads, repairing valve issues, and addressing wiring problems within the system. Homeowners often seek these services to ensure their irrigation systems operate efficiently, prevent water waste, and maintain consistent watering schedules throughout the growing season.
Before requesting inground sprinkler repair,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the work involved, including whether the repair will require excavation or system adjustments. It’s also helpful to know if the repair will address specific problems like uneven watering, system shutdowns, or low water pressure. Clarifying these details can assist homeowners in preparing for the service and ensuring their irrigation systems are properly maintained for optimal performance.

Inground Sprinkler Repair Questions
What are common signs of sprinkler system issues? Symptoms include uneven watering, low pressure, or visible leaks around sprinkler heads.
Can damaged sprinkler heads be repaired? Yes, sprinkler heads can often be repaired or replaced to restore proper watering coverage.
What causes sprinkler system leaks? Leaks may result from broken pipes, damaged fittings, or worn-out seals within the system.
Is it possible to upgrade an existing sprinkler system? Yes, upgrades can improve efficiency, coverage, and water savings through modern components and controllers.
